The Art Behind the Perfect Curved Z
Mastering the curved cursive Z is less about complexity and more about intention. Begin with a smooth, upward start from the baseline—letter form gracefully rising before spiraling gently downward. The key is consistency: keep your strokes flowing with moderate pressure to create a balanced, seamless curve. Practice tracing the shape slowly, focusing on symmetry and continuity to reinforce muscle memory.
This deliberate motion not only enhances legibility but also imbues your writing with rhythm and intentionality, making each letter feel purposeful.

Tips to Perfect Your Curved Cursive Z
- Start Slow: Practice forming Zs in isolation before integrating them into full words.
- Use the Right Tools: A smooth-writing pen or high-quality notebook encourages fluid movement.
- Emphasize the Arc: Imagine drawing a soft, extended loop—each curve should connect naturally.
- Balance Symmetry: Ensure both sides of the Z are evenly shaped—uneven curves can disrupt elegance.
- Add Personal Style: Experiment with subtle flourishes or embellishments to make your Z uniquely yours.
